If all goes to plan my falco will be OTR early next month, she's been standing for over 2 years because of legal shit with DVLA.
My to do list is
new tyres
new chainset
new K&N
replace all fluid and coolant
replace blue spring pogo stick unit
Id only had the bike 3 months before DVLA revoked my license,therefore not that experienced in falco ways so if I need to add anything to the jobsheet please shout !
Cheers Paul
